Job description

Description
Under the supervision of the Division Administrator, the Hospital Laboratory Technician II (HLT II) is responsible for the on-call preservation, procurement, and transportation of cadaveric donor organs for transplantation. This position plays a critical role in ensuring compliance with regulatory requirements, maintaining organ viability, and coordinating with multidisciplinary transplant teams. Responsibilities include but are not limited to:
  • Perform on-call organ procurement, preservation, and transportation activities for cadaveric donor organs.
  • Verify donor and recipient medical information to ensure organ and tissue compatibility.
  • Review donor medical records to confirm consent, medical and social history, and other required clinical information.
  • Complete intraoperative documentation, operative reports, and specimen labeling in accordance with UCLA policies, UNOS standards, CMS regulations, and HIPAA requirements.
  • Utilize sterile techniques to perfuse and preserve donor organs following UCLA standard operating procedures and transplant protocols.
  • Coordinate medical evacuation (medevac) transportation to and from donor facilities.
  • Serve as a communication liaison between procurement teams, transplant centers, and organ procurement organizations to ensure timely exchange of critical information.
  • Oversee the safe, efficient, and timely transport of donor organs to UCLA Medical Center.
  • Assist with the proper packaging and handling of donor organs to maintain organ integrity and regulatory compliance.
  • Maintain inventory and availability of procurement and preservation supplies, including recovery packs, perfusion supplies, preservation solutions, coolers, and related equipment.
  • Collect and maintain data for Quality Assurance and Performance Improvement (QAPI) initiatives, clinical studies, and transplant program projects under the direction of the Chief of Procurement and Transplant Services QA Manager.
  • Support continuous quality improvement efforts and adherence to transplant program standards and best practices.
